Flooring help please? Quotes for tiles / laminate

brownbake
Posts: 561 Forumite
Hi we are considering getting our long narrow hall and kitchen tiled. It is in total 19m2.
We were quoted for the reasonably square 9m2 kitchen £262 and £ 300 for the 10m2 hallway which is long and narrow.
This works out at around £30 per m2. This is for labour and adhesive and grout.
Alternatively we were thinking of getting the kitchen tiled and getting laminate in the hall. Does anyone know how much is the average charge for labour for fitting laminate per m2?
